Pittard Clinic is a licensed substance use treatment provider in Toccoa, GA, listed in the SAMHSA treatment directory. Outpatient care is offered, so clients can keep living at home between scheduled sessions. Methadone is available as part of medication assisted treatment for opioid use disorder. Buprenorphine (Suboxone) is offered to reduce opioid cravings and lower relapse and overdose risk. It serves young adults, adults, seniors.
